That experience also taught me the importance of having the right equipment. The ideal flat pedal isn’t an exact science, however. There’s no specific number of pins, particular platform dimensions, or precise pin placement that’s baked into the perfect recipe for grip and control. I’ve tested concave and convex versions in all shapes and sizes with a variety of pin lengths and styles. I’ve also tried multiple pedal body materials. My favorite, hands down, is composite plastic. It’s less expensive, light, remarkably durable, and more importantly, it shrugs off impacts and absorbs the shock of violent pedal strikes, unlike aluminum, which can transfer the impact and trigger an outcome far more severe than a bent pin. Some of my worst crashes have been from clipping an alloy pedal on a rock while cornering during a technical descent. In my experience, a plastic pedal provides a significant buffer, almost like a bumper.
That’s one thing the Tectonic Alibi has going for it, and what piqued my interest in the first place—aside from Miles’s review of the Alibi’s predecessor, the Altar. The Altar was made in the USA from a proprietary carbon-reinforced nylon with a similar shape and design to the Alibi. However, it cost $200—and that was 2022 pricing. The Durango, Colorado, brand has since revamped it in aluminum alloy and subsequently released the Alibi as a more affordable composite model that’s now manufactured overseas.
The Tectonic Alibi pedal body is made from “ReVibe,” a unique composite consisting of 70% nylon and 30% carbon fiber by volume. The nylon is sourced entirely from recovered ocean plastic, while approximately 20% of the carbon fiber comes from factory waste generated by Taiwan’s bicycle industry, resulting in roughly 75% recycled content overall. “Nylon is a highly recyclable material with very little loss in its properties, and recycled carbon fiber is ideal for injection molding,” Tectonic founder Andrew McKee said. “The result is a pedal body that’s both lighter and stronger than aluminum, and a return to the original concept that inspired this project.”
Fault-Justifying Design
Now, onto the meat, which thus far hasn’t been from my shins. The Alibi got its name from the literal definition of the word, to justify a fault. It “helps keep you out of trouble,” which is usually slipping a foot when it comes to pedals. It’s a clever concept considering that I think this pedal actually accomplishes that task better than any other pedal I’ve used. For one, they’re incredibly grippy. I’d argue that they’re the most sure-footed flat pedal I’ve used. The size, shape, and placement of the 10 pins per side and the large 108mm (W) x 128mm (L) dual concave platform all contribute to this.
They’re tenaciously tacky both descending and climbing, yet somehow they don’t make it difficult to reorient your foot placement. I’ve ridden a few different shoes on them, and even the least sticky rubber soles are highly effective on the Alibi. I’ve ridden out a line with my foot improperly placed or only half on the pedal on plenty of occasions. The size and shape, and claw-like pins, have a very stable feel that doesn’t seem like it’s going to rotate out from under you when your foot isn’t in the right position.
The alibi analogy also fits my point about the forgiving quality of composite pedal bodies. They’re a little more lenient when slamming into rocks or roots at high speed. I’ve hit a fair few with the Tectonics while riding Oaxaca’s rutted and rocky singletrack and have yet to take a big tumble as a result. Knock on wood three times. That said, folks who are riding bikes with low bottom brackets should consider the size of these platforms. As shown in the comparison shots, they’re a little larger than others, and they don’t have intricate angles designed to avoid pedal strikes.
Still, the size of the Tectonic Alibi pedal bodies is one of its major strengths. They’re longer than most other options and are incredibly comfortable as a result. The only pedal I’ve tried that’s bigger is the freakish Pedaling Innovations Catalyst, which I found to be way too large, particularly for riding chunky singletrack. I wear a size 10-ish shoe, and the Alibi is perfect for both trail riding and extended rides, such as all-day-everyday bikepacking.
The “Sharktooth” pins might be the most impressive part of Tectonic’s design. This patented, full-length stainless steel system allows each pin to pass completely through the pedal body, where it’s secured by a side-loading retention bolt, creating a textured traction pin on both sides. Not only does this eliminate the risk of stripped threads, but it also makes bent pins easy to replace. I’d also argue that their beefier construction makes them more durable than typical threaded pins. After all the abuse I put them through, I inspected each one closely. A couple showed signs of wear, but none were bent or significantly damaged. Each pedal uses six long pins, four short pins, and 10 retaining bolts.
Durability and Reliability
As mentioned above, I’ve been privy to many tales of pedal failures on bikepacking trips. I’ve undoubtedly heard the most stories from Alexandera Houchin, who’s broken enough pedals over the years to become understandably skeptical of most designs. She snapped a pair of Race Face Chesters at the axle during the 2019 Unbound XL, stripped a set of Race Face Atlas pedals off their spindle during the 2019 Tour Divide, seized a OneUp Alloy pedal on her 2021 Arizona Trail Race attempt, and pulled a Deity TMAC pedal off its spindle during a short tour. Those experiences led her to replace her pedals before every major race. As of a few years ago, the Tectonic Altar was the first pedal she claimed not to have to worry about.
The Tectonic Alibi doesn’t have the same internals as the Altar, however. The Alibi runs on a single outer bearing and an IGUS bushing (vs. four bearings in the Altar). Tectonic moved away from the full bearing setup of the Altar, removing the inboard bearing bulge and providing a less complicated pedal body design. This also streamlined the manufacturing process, thus halving the cost to consumers. According to Tectonic, these internal changes also increased the service intervals, since the bushing can run longer without issues.
When you do have to service it, it looks pretty straightforward. The only “special tool” required is an 8mm deep socket. I actually had one of these, but when I wanted to break these pedals down for photos the other day, it was nowhere to be found. The ghost in my workshop must have taken it. He seems to do that for things that I suddenly need. Either way, here’s a diagram from Tectonic that shows the simple layout. The 686 bearing and 12x14x12 (IDxODxW) metric sleeve IGUS bushing are both common sizes. As Andrew explained, “If you were to be dropped into a McMaster warehouse, you could walk out with all the rolling elements you needed to refresh a pair of Alibis.”
I’ve now put well over 1,000 miles on this pair of Alibis, and haven’t yet needed to service them. There’s no play in the bearings or bushings, and they’re running smoothly.
- Model Tested: Tectonic Alibi Pedals
- Actual Weight (pair): 396 grams (13.97 oz)
- Place of Manufacture: Taiwan
- Price: $100
- Manufacturer’s Details: Tectonic
Pros
- Best-in-class grip
- Forgiving and very stable
- Pedal body material is tough and recycled
- Interesting and rugged pin design
- Large, lengthy platform is comfortable for long rides
Cons
- Not as affordable as other composite pedals
- Large platform and non-angled edge design might not play well with low BBs
- Plenty long, but might not be wide enough for some people’s tastes
Wrap Up
The Tectonic Alibi has earned a top spot alongside the handful of flat pedals I genuinely recommend without hesitation. It combines the impact-friendly nature of a composite body with class-leading grip, an exceptionally stable platform, and reliable construction. After more than 1,000 miles of rocky trails in Oaxaca, the bearings are still smooth, and the body has shrugged off quite a few pedal strikes.
Perhaps what impressed me most is that the Alibi doesn’t use the same formula many flat pedals were built around. It’s a simple design with a very generous platform, an aggressive pin layout, a recycled composite construction, and straightforward internals. If you value outright grip and a larger pedal body, especially for long rides and remote adventures where a pedal failure can quickly become trip-ending, the Alibi should be on your list. For me, it has become the new benchmark for flat pedals—so much so that I just bought my second pair.
